LocalChrome.prototype.startChrome = function () {
return __awaiter(this, void 0, void 0, function () {
var port, _a, target;
return __generator(this, function (_b) {
switch (_b.label) {
case 0:
port = this.options.cdp.port;
_a = this;
return [4 /*yield*/, chrome_launcher_1.launch({
logLevel: this.options.debug ? 'info' : 'silent',
chromeFlags: [
// Do not render scroll bars
'--hide-scrollbars',
// The following options copied verbatim from https://github.com/GoogleChrome/chrome-launcher/blob/master/src/flags.ts
// Disable built-in Google Translate service
'--disable-translate',
// Disable all chrome extensions entirely
'--disable-extensions',
// Disable various background network services, including extension updating,
// safe browsing service, upgrade detector, translate, UMA
'--disable-background-networking',
// Disable fetching safebrowsing lists, likely redundant due to disable-background-networking
'--safebrowsing-disable-auto-update',
// Disable syncing to a Google account
'--disable-sync',
// Disable reporting to UMA, but allows for collection
'--metrics-recording-only',
// Disable installation of default apps on first run
'--disable-default-apps',
// Mute any audio
'--mute-audio',
// Skip first run wizards
'--no-first-run',
],
port: port,
})];
case 1:
_a.chromeInstance = _b.sent();
return [4 /*yield*/, CDP.New({
port: port,
})];
case 2:
target = _b.sent();
return [4 /*yield*/, CDP({ target: target, port: port })];
case 3: return [2 /*return*/, _b.sent()];
}
});
});
};
